The Australian Seafood Show on Aqueduct Road in Melbourne is a delightful experience for seafood enthusiasts and anyone interested in the rich tapestry of Australia's seafood industry. This informative and educational show dives deep into the world of Australian seafood, showcasing the hard work and dedication of fishermen who bring fresh catches from our pristine waters to our plates.
Visitors can expect to learn about various fishing methods and the sustainable practices that support local fisheries. The show highlights not only the delicious varieties of seafood available but also emphasizes the importance of supporting local industries. With engaging presentations and interactive elements, attendees leave with a greater appreciation for the craftsmanship behind their favorite dishes.
